a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'media-gfx')
-rw-r--r--media-gfx/graphviz/Manifest2
-rw-r--r--media-gfx/graphviz/graphviz-2.38.0-r1.ebuild9
2 files changed, 7 insertions, 4 deletions
diff --git a/media-gfx/graphviz/Manifest b/media-gfx/graphviz/Manifest
index 14483520..481093f4 100644
--- a/media-gfx/graphviz/Manifest
+++ b/media-gfx/graphviz/Manifest
@@ -3,4 +3,4 @@ AUX graphviz-2.34.0-dot-pangocairo-link.patch 950 SHA256 1f44e988d99dc1781266b5c
DIST graphviz-2.36.0.tar.gz 23846318 SHA256 37fd66d8def158575c75c4f6dbf536839e4ee468aa59314eb472d1aecb076361 SHA512 cca1339cea8d36acbae647a78ff6743a4f77bfa208e74fef615a99dc7d380d2a0a0f0b3fc00de09a9f67c3fad16dc3837ef3aefbfce5a8a3d0f974ed5afbbab5 WHIRLPOOL c9f25f28869afef943121a24b580518d822eb76f30b4c874554f2f1dd4f16ffaf2683644c59746f4295aa574c4b5541f1205787870eed5567cd4bd5c755e5f8b
DIST graphviz-2.38.0.tar.gz 25848858 SHA256 81aa238d9d4a010afa73a9d2a704fc3221c731e1e06577c2ab3496bdef67859e SHA512 0e51a97dae595f4e80bc9e4a12ba3c48485fab19941a28d522f5a0624b6a767e0ba720e9e55bff8efe8308dd1cd3793e2c99cb5fdfceb2d5cafb0cbee907e531 WHIRLPOOL b59bb517c4aa690ffd23e1b4d448d5dbaae5594eb1059d574e0cb3bf2091beb9ed867bd4fa7e8ca0259863f24849c96d4d1da056091922bf33ace7da43c8b5d4
EBUILD graphviz-2.36.0.ebuild 7550 SHA256 c2c5c9fbd4b384601383d9354ca9478ae0224d2f95bc959cbe973d57c65879f5 SHA512 65b29a7c95ea5ddf6c8c84c12a9cf37b4303959d854137c929d7ec143c1424d47f0003155e2853ef588cb6a111d3b6a31be99be0560cd9c73a0174b61cd047d6 WHIRLPOOL 5f02b5dc85d1775a8304f35960449810e540b0ac2c1d3284e0532c6bf7ade89215a81d7dd9e139955eb1307b1115b2efbee56ddf1382803380497ca4c8a1f3c2
-EBUILD graphviz-2.38.0-r1.ebuild 7741 SHA256 b75d4dde5959a3602c7c7a88eecc3665554bf209cbe6587f8f6d30a964d4abd7 SHA512 b2e06e5031117287365ec14fe6e87d7b3fbbc120ef1b9768b592d61a771d2ab61aebb56453bf79c94bb945310d4b4b988fb1c70f91a9368a34c334b7d07f0faa WHIRLPOOL 37dbc07c937482c73430e738dd80a443674b596eb7dd98806ff170a9d2acb414f60e3d8fa868b0ed834f6c06889c05d6d6ba9a19753fdc0790a62b5fcc53c9c8
+EBUILD graphviz-2.38.0-r1.ebuild 7898 SHA256 d81cfdfadecd3a07b70d79e5249ae30a34750436247e72d671f4b65a7931d5f8 SHA512 8aa5af204e2d3c743a8b31d7c10d90330d4ab59b339ea7aaf8854d0c153db8e6279936473e899175011d578d5ea81ea5d5121bfa7dc52b4ea5fa5af67fa0f91c WHIRLPOOL ce2d92c4b02490438a38b3783f111d2d364be51a009c987c1e98cd552173d3405a43d070dcdaf13f9a10bf3a1a2b0ad3f3564656804c07afac12f9f1a972c4d9
diff --git a/media-gfx/graphviz/graphviz-2.38.0-r1.ebuild b/media-gfx/graphviz/graphviz-2.38.0-r1.ebuild
index abca011a..d1adda33 100644
--- a/media-gfx/graphviz/graphviz-2.38.0-r1.ebuild
+++ b/media-gfx/graphviz/graphviz-2.38.0-r1.ebuild
@@ -1,11 +1,11 @@
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Id: d9fb22ac7865edea7e9e5b57074a21f7f17ca8a6 $
+# $Id: 254dfa104db99af3309e4c43f946d09b609f9a98 $
EAPI=5
PYTHON_COMPAT=( python2_7 )
-inherit autotools eutils flag-o-matic java-pkg-opt-2 multilib python-single-r1
+inherit autotools eutils flag-o-matic java-pkg-opt-2 multilib python-single-r1 qmake-utils
DESCRIPTION="Open Source Graph Visualization Software"
HOMEPAGE="http://www.graphviz.org/"
@@ -26,7 +26,7 @@ RDEPEND="
dev-libs/libltdl:0
>=media-libs/fontconfig-2.3.95
>=media-libs/freetype-2.1.10
- >=media-libs/gd-2.0.34[fontconfig,jpeg,png,truetype,zlib]
+ >=media-libs/gd-2.0.34:=[fontconfig,jpeg,png,truetype,zlib]
>=media-libs/libpng-1.2:0
!<=sci-chemistry/cluster-1.3.081231
virtual/jpeg:0
@@ -166,6 +166,9 @@ src_prepare() {
# replace the whitespace with tabs
sed -i -e 's: :\t:g' doc/info/Makefile.am || die
+ # use correct version of qmake. bug #567236
+ sed -i -e "/AC_CHECK_PROGS(QMAKE/a AC_SUBST(QMAKE,$(qt4_get_bindir)/qmake)" configure.ac || die
+
# workaround for http://www.graphviz.org/mantisbt/view.php?id=1895
use elibc_FreeBSD && append-flags $(test-flags -fno-builtin-sincos)